Dole Packaged Foods has unveiled a major expansion of its fast-growing Dole Whip retail offerings, introducing new formats and a tropical flavor that accentuates smooth, creamy texture and real fruit flavor – all without dairy or high fructose corn syrup. Its new Tropical Guava Passion offering has joined Pineapple and Mango flavors now available in the frozen section of grocery stores across North America.

Boasting a real fruit foundation and creamy texture, the Dole Whip retail range isn’t ice cream, sorbet, sherbet, or gelato. The rollout is being presented a step into establishing a new frozen dessert category anchored in fruit-first indulgence.
The products have been stocked at Albertson’s, Harris Teeter, Publix, Ralph’s, Stop & Shop, Hannaford, Target, and other grocery stores and supermarkets, with a seasonal listing scheduled at Costco this spring.
